Coulometric reduction of sulphide tarnish films on tin

Abstract:

The technique for estimating the thickness of tarnish films on tin, by coulometric reduction in sodium carbonate solutions, has been examined in detail. The cathode current efficiency of reduction for two sulphides of tin has been measured and found to vary with current density employed. The main constituent has a high reduction efficiency (> 92% for current densities > 0.35 mA/cm2) but a secondary and minor constituent has a low reduction efficiency (55%) due to its more negative reduction potential.


Reference:
WOLYNEC, S.; GABE, D.R. Coulometric reduction of sulphide tarnish films on tin. British Corrosion Journal, v. 6, n. 11, p. 271-4, nov., 1971.
